How they compare
Philippines currently reports 0.9996 GPIA against 0.9935 GPIA in Nepal, a difference of 0.0061 GPIA.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 6 shared years of data; in 2014 it was Philippines ahead.
Nepal ranks 81st and Philippines ranks 78th of 99 countries.
Philippines has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
